Game 10 Final: Semifinals - George Mason 53 - UNC Wilmington 41

> Live on-location in Richmond, VA at the CAA Tournament

Well the CAA Tournament Final is set and there is going to be plenty of green and yellow in the building tomorrow. Despite hitting just four field goals in the second half George Mason did enough defensively to come away with the win. The Patriots held UNC Wilmington to just 28.6% shooting from the field, including a paltry 4-23 from beyond the arc.

Folarin Campbell led the way with a team high 15 points, doing the majority of his damage at the charity stripe where he was a solid 9-14. Louis Birdsong continued his strong play in the tournament, scoring 10 points on 5-7 shooting and Will Thomas cleaned up on the glass with 11 rebounds.

Vladimir Kuljanin played a great game inside for UNCW recording a double-double with 10 points and 12 rebounds but it wasn’t enough. A day after running Delaware out of the building, the Seahawks had all types of struggles with the Mason defense.
